Divas shine to deny Redgate league title

Winter Rounders THE Eagley Winter Rounders League completed its programme on Sunday and there were some interesting results.

Davies XI, who have finished third, beat Divas by 22 runs and prevented them taking the title from Redgate Ladies who had already completed their fixtures.

The other match saw Darcy Blues put up a tremendous performance against Eagley Pike to claw their way off the bottom of the table and swap places with Eagley.

Redgate Ladies have retained the championship and Divas have had to settle for second place.

In the Farnworth League, BYP Ladies A completed their season with victory over their B team and lead the table by one point ahead of Elton Vale who had an innings win over Little Lever CC.

Elton, however, have a game in hand and victory over Wallys Eleven will make them the champions.
